Understanding MMS and Its Limitations

MMS is a standard for sending multimedia content, such as images, videos, and audio files, over cellular networks. While MMS has been widely used for sending small to medium-sized files, it has its limitations when it comes to sending large videos. The main limitation of MMS is the file size limit, which varies depending on the carrier and the device being used. Typically, the file size limit for MMS is around 300 KB to 1 MB, which is relatively small compared to the size of modern video files.

Using Cloud-Based Storage

Cloud-based storage services, such as Google Drive and Dropbox, can also be used to send large videos via MMS. These services allow users to upload their videos to the cloud and share a link to the video via MMS. This method eliminates the need to send the actual video file via MMS, making it possible to send large videos without exceeding the file size limit.

What are the alternatives to sending large videos via MMS?

There are several alternatives to sending large videos via MMS, including email, cloud-based file sharing services, and social media platforms. Email services such as Gmail, Yahoo, and Outlook allow users to send large video files as attachments, often with larger file size limits than MMS. Cloud-based file sharing services like Dropbox, Google Drive, and OneDrive enable users to upload and share large video files with others, either publicly or privately. Social media platforms like Facebook, Twitter, and Instagram also allow users to upload and share videos, often with larger file size limits and better video quality.

These alternatives offer several advantages over MMS, including larger file size limits, better video quality, and more flexible sharing options.
